Topic: It is generally agreed that society benefits from the work of its members. Compare the contributions of artists to society with the contributions of scientists to society. Which type of contribution do you think is valued more by your society? Give specific reasons to support your answer.
 
 

Everyone contributes to society in a variety of ways. For example, medical researchers develop cures for a variety of diseases, physicists develop faster microchips and engineers may develop more efficient energy sources. Artists on the other hand, contribute to society, but in a different manner. Artists contribute to cultural advancement and marvels such as the Sistine Chapel that are remembered for centuries. Since technological advancements build on one another and are quickly forgotten about, I believe the contributions of artists are more important than those of scientists.

First, artists provide entertainment. After a long day at work or school, people need time to relax and relieve the stress that built up during the day. Many people relax by watching movies, listening to music, or playing video games. All of these activities are not the contributions of scientists, but rather the end product of artists. Consider the example of the Playstation 3, a common video game console. While the Playstation 3's graphics and processing speed may be the work of scientists, by itself, it is useless. The appeal of such a device is in the games that can be played on it, rather than the game itself. The stories and graphics of these games, are all works designed by artists rather than the scientists.

Second, artists greatly influence the culture or a society. Great parts of modern life are influenced by the artists of our times, regardless of whether people know them by name or not. The most appealing aspects of video games, famous drawings and sketches, sculptures, are all the creations of artists that can be enjoyed by everyone for centuries. This fame is something scientists rarely, if ever, achieve.

Lastly, artists allow people to view the characteristics of others and to see their own personal characteristics in an unbiased view. Artists creates play where one can watch how other people behave in a given situation and force viewers to put themselves in the actor's place through carefully crafted story lines and dialog. Even in cinema, viewers can see how other people live and behave. Art is about creating and showing a specific point of view to others.

In conclusion, I believe that artists contribute to society more than scientists because of the nature and influence of their contributions. Their creations both sooth and inflame society, helping people find passion for life rather than just added convenience. This is something that science will rarely accomplish.
